Skip to content

Commit e4c0227

Browse files
committed
Added support for net10.0
1 parent 542bb55 commit e4c0227

File tree

3 files changed

+18
-1
lines changed

3 files changed

+18
-1
lines changed

MimeKit/MimeKit.csproj

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,7 @@
88
<Authors>Jeffrey Stedfast</Authors>
99
<_LegacyFrameworks>net462;net47</_LegacyFrameworks>
1010
<_LegacyFrameworks Condition=" Exists('C:\Windows') ">$(_LegacyFrameworks);net48</_LegacyFrameworks>
11-
<TargetFrameworks>$(_LegacyFrameworks);netstandard2.0;netstandard2.1;net8.0</TargetFrameworks>
11+
<TargetFrameworks>$(_LegacyFrameworks);netstandard2.0;netstandard2.1;net8.0;net10.0</TargetFrameworks>
1212
<GenerateDocumentationFile>true</GenerateDocumentationFile>
1313
<AssemblyName>MimeKit</AssemblyName>
1414
<PackageId>MimeKit</PackageId>
@@ -77,6 +77,10 @@
7777
<PackageReference Include="System.Security.Cryptography.Pkcs" Version="8.0.1" />
7878
</ItemGroup>
7979

80+
<ItemGroup Condition=" $(TargetFramework.StartsWith('net10')) ">
81+
<PackageReference Include="System.Security.Cryptography.Pkcs" Version="10.0.0" />
82+
</ItemGroup>
83+
8084
<ItemGroup Condition=" $(TargetFramework.StartsWith('netstandard2.')) ">
8185
<PackageReference Include="System.Text.Encoding.CodePages" Version="8.0.0" />
8286
</ItemGroup>

nuget/MimeKit.nuspec

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-86,6 +86,10 @@
8686
<dependency id="System.Security.Cryptography.Pkcs" version="8.0.1" />
8787
<dependency id="BouncyCastle.Cryptography" version="2.6.1" />
8888
</group>
89+
<group targetFramework="net10.0">
90+
<dependency id="System.Security.Cryptography.Pkcs" version="10.0.0" />
91+
<dependency id="BouncyCastle.Cryptography" version="2.6.1" />
92+
</group>
8993
<group targetFramework="netstandard2.0">
9094
<dependency id="System.Security.Cryptography.Pkcs" version="8.0.1" />
9195
<dependency id="System.Text.Encoding.CodePages" version="8.0.0" />
@@ -125,6 +129,10 @@
125129
<file src="..\MimeKit\bin\Release\net8.0\MimeKit.pdb" target="lib\net8.0\MimeKit.pdb" />
126130
<file src="..\MimeKit\bin\Release\net8.0\MimeKit.xml" target="lib\net8.0\MimeKit.xml" />
127131
<file src="..\MimeKit\bin\Release\net8.0\MimeKit.dll.config" target="lib\net8.0\MimeKit.dll.config" />
132+
<file src="..\MimeKit\bin\Release\net10.0\MimeKit.dll" target="lib\net10.0\MimeKit.dll" />
133+
<file src="..\MimeKit\bin\Release\net10.0\MimeKit.pdb" target="lib\net10.0\MimeKit.pdb" />
134+
<file src="..\MimeKit\bin\Release\net10.0\MimeKit.xml" target="lib\net10.0\MimeKit.xml" />
135+
<file src="..\MimeKit\bin\Release\net10.0\MimeKit.dll.config" target="lib\net10.0\MimeKit.dll.config" />
128136
<file src="mimekit-50.png" target="icons\mimekit-50.png" />
129137
</files>
130138
</package>

nuget/MimeKitLite.nuspec

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-62,6 +62,7 @@
6262
<dependency id="System.Memory" version="4.6.3" />
6363
</group>
6464
<group targetFramework="net8.0" />
65+
<group targetFramework="net10.0" />
6566
<group targetFramework="netstandard2.0">
6667
<dependency id="System.Text.Encoding.CodePages" version="8.0.0" />
6768
<dependency id="System.Buffers" version="4.6.1" />
@@ -96,6 +97,10 @@
9697
<file src="..\MimeKit\bin\Release\net8.0\MimeKitLite.pdb" target="lib\net8.0\MimeKitLite.pdb" />
9798
<file src="..\MimeKit\bin\Release\net8.0\MimeKitLite.xml" target="lib\net8.0\MimeKitLite.xml" />
9899
<file src="..\MimeKit\bin\Release\net8.0\MimeKitLite.dll.config" target="lib\net8.0\MimeKitLite.dll.config" />
100+
<file src="..\MimeKit\bin\Release\net10.0\MimeKitLite.dll" target="lib\net10.0\MimeKitLite.dll" />
101+
<file src="..\MimeKit\bin\Release\net10.0\MimeKitLite.pdb" target="lib\net10.0\MimeKitLite.pdb" />
102+
<file src="..\MimeKit\bin\Release\net10.0\MimeKitLite.xml" target="lib\net10.0\MimeKitLite.xml" />
103+
<file src="..\MimeKit\bin\Release\net10.0\MimeKitLite.dll.config" target="lib\net10.0\MimeKitLite.dll.config" />
99104
<file src="mimekit-50.png" target="icons\mimekit-50.png" />
100105
</files>
101106
</package>

0 commit comments

Comments
 (0)